Williams v. Rivera
Petitioner: Richard Williams
Respondent: Mildred Rivera
Case Number: 9:2012cv01537
Filed: June 11, 2012
Court: US District Court for the District of South Carolina
Office: Beaufort Office
County: Hampton
Presiding Judge: J Michelle Childs
Presiding Judge: Bristow Marchant
Nature of Suit: Habeas Corpus (General)
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 2241 Petition for Writ of Habeas Corpus (Federal)
Jury Demanded By: None

May 11, 2015 Opinion or Order Filing 39 ORDER AND OPINION accepting 23 Report and Recommendation of Magistrate Judge Bristow Marchant. Petitioner's Petition for Writ of Habeas Corpus (ECF No. 1 ) is DISMISSED with prejudice. In this case, the legal standard for the issuance of a certificate of appealability has not been met. Signed by Honorable J Michelle Childs on 5/11/2015.(ssam, )
May 3, 2013 Opinion or Order Filing 26 JUDGMENT : This action is dismissed without prejudice. The Petitioner shall take nothing on his petition filed pursuant to Title 28 U.S.C. § 2241. A certificate of appealability is denied. (hhil, )
